Container With Most Water

Given n non-negative integers a1, a2, ..., an, where each represents a point at coordinate (i, ai). n vertical lines are drawn such that the two endpoints of line i is at (i, ai) and (i, 0). Find two lines, which together with x-axis forms a container, such that the container contains the most water.

Notice

You may not slant the container.

Example Given [1,3,2], the max area of the container is 2.

Solution: From two sides to the middle and keep a max record result.

public int maxArea(int[] heights) {
    if(heights == null || heights.length == 0) {
        return 0;
    }
    int left = 0, right = heights.length - 1;
    int res = 0;
    while(left < right) {
        int rec = Math.min(heights[left], heights[right]) * (right - left);
        res = Math.max(rec, res);
        if(heights[left] < heights[right]) {
            left++;
        }
        else {
            right--;
        }
    }
    return res;
}
